循环语句

2025-05-06 04:56:14
循环语句

循环语句的定义与重要性

循环语句是编程语言中的一种控制结构,允许程序在特定条件下重复执行一段代码。它是实现自动化和高效算法的基础之一,广泛应用于数据处理、分析及报表生成等领域。在商业分析、数据科学和技术开发等行业中,循环语句的运用极大地提高了工作效率,降低了人为错误的概率。

在通信行业,面对繁琐的报表统计工作,提升效率至关重要。本培训旨在通过陈则老师的指导,让学员掌握经分报表的梳理及自动化技能,解放重复劳动,实现数据分析的转型。课程内容涵盖Excel和PPT的自动化操作,从基础的宏和VBA知识到实际
chenze 陈则 培训咨询

循环语句的基本类型

在大多数编程语言中,循环语句通常分为以下几种主要类型:

  • for循环:适用于已知循环次数的场景,通常用于遍历数组或集合中的元素。
  • while循环:适用于在满足某个条件之前需要重复执行的情况,适合于条件驱动的循环。
  • do...while循环:与while循环相似,但至少会执行一次循环体,因为条件判断在循环体之后进行。

循环语句在VBA中的应用

在Excel VBA中,循环语句被广泛应用于数据处理和报表自动化。通过使用循环语句,用户能够快速处理大量数据,从而提升工作效率。例如,在进行经分报表的自动化时,VBA中的循环语句可以用于遍历多个工作表,合并数据,生成最终的报表。

for循环的使用示例

以下是一个简单的for循环示例,用于遍历Excel工作表中的数据:

For i = 1 To 10
    Cells(i, 1).Value = i * 10
Next i

上述代码将1到10的数字乘以10,并将结果依次填入第一列中。这种方式极大地简化了手动输入数据的过程。

while循环的应用示例

while循环可以用于在满足条件时持续执行特定操作,例如在处理缺失值时:

Dim i As Integer
i = 1
While Cells(i, 1).Value <> ""
    ' 处理数据
    i = i + 1
Wend

这段代码将遍历第一列,直到遇到空单元格为止,有效地处理了数据中的缺失值。

循环语句在数据分析中的重要性

在数据分析中,循环语句能够有效处理复杂的数据集,进行批量操作。比如,在进行经营分析时,分析人员需要对各类报表进行统计和计算,这时循环语句提供了极大的便利,使得数据处理从手动操作转向自动化处理,进而提升了分析的准确性和效率。

案例分析:经分报表的自动化

在通信行业,经分人员每月需统计大量数据并生成报表。传统的手动统计不仅耗时,而且容易出错。通过使用VBA中的循环语句,分析人员可以快速合并多个数据源,生成最终的报表。例如,使用for循环遍历多个工作表,并将其数据整合到一个主工作表中,显著减少了人工操作时间。

循环语句的最佳实践

在使用循环语句时,有一些最佳实践可以遵循,以提高代码的可读性和执行效率:

  • 避免嵌套循环:尽量减少循环的嵌套层数,以提高代码的可读性和效率。
  • 使用适当的数据结构:选择合适的数据结构(如数组、集合)来存储数据,可以提高循环的效率。
  • 进行性能优化:在处理大数据集时,可以考虑使用更高效的算法或数据处理方式,减少循环的执行次数。

循环语句的挑战与解决方案

尽管循环语句在编程中非常有用,但在使用过程中也可能遇到一些挑战。以下是一些常见的问题及其解决方案:

无限循环的风险

无限循环是指循环条件始终为真,导致程序无法终止。这种问题通常会导致程序崩溃或严重的性能问题。为避免出现无限循环,程序员需要确保循环条件在某个时刻会变为假,并在必要时设置最大循环次数的限制。

性能问题

在处理大量数据时,循环语句可能导致性能下降。为此,可以考虑使用更高效的算法,或将某些操作移出循环体,以减少每次循环的计算量。例如,在VBA中,可以通过减少与Excel的交互次数来提高性能。

循环语句在教育与培训中的应用

在教育和培训领域,循环语句的应用也逐渐增多。通过对循环语句的教学,学生可以更好地理解程序的逻辑结构,培养良好的编程习惯。在实际的课程中,例如“经营分析报表自动化”的培训中,循环语句的使用可以帮助学员掌握高效的数据处理技巧,提升他们的分析能力。

总结

循环语句在编程中扮演着重要的角色,尤其是在数据处理和分析的场景中。无论是在VBA中进行Excel报表自动化,还是在其他编程环境中,循环语句都能够极大地提高工作效率,减少人为错误。通过不断学习和实践循环语句的应用,分析人员和开发者能够更好地应对复杂的数据处理任务,推动业务的发展。

未来,随着数据分析技术的不断进步,循环语句的应用将更加广泛。掌握循环语句的使用,将为从事相关工作的人员提供更强的竞争力。无论是在传统的经济分析领域,还是在新兴的数据科学领域,循环语句的灵活运用都将成为推动工作效率和创新的重要工具。

免责声明:本站所提供的内容均来源于网友提供或网络分享、搜集,由本站编辑整理,仅供个人研究、交流学习使用。如涉及版权问题,请联系本站管理员予以更改或删除。
上一篇:多文件合并
下一篇:数据来源分析

添加企业微信

1V1服务,高效匹配老师
欢迎各种培训合作扫码联系,我们将竭诚为您服务
本课程名称:/

填写信息,即有专人与您沟通